Saugus Union School District. Saugus Union School District (SUSD) is a public California school district located in Santa Clarita, Los Angeles County, California. The district serves students in grades TK/K-6 in Saugus, most of Valencia, and parts of Canyon Country. There are also pre-school programs on-site at many of the schools.

The New Revolution (formerly known as Revolution, Great American Revolution and La Revolución) is a steel roller coaster located at Six Flags Magic Mountain in Valencia, California. Manufactured by Anton Schwarzkopf and designed by Werner Stengel, the roller coaster opened to the public on May 8, 1976.

The Santa Clarita Valley is about 20 miles (32 km) from the Burbank Bob Hope Airport, and about 35 miles (56 km) from Los Angeles International Airport. It is home to the 262-acre (106 ha) theme park Six Flags Magic Mountain which includes the gated waterpark Six Flags Hurricane Harbor.
